[prev in list] [next in list] [prev in thread] [next in thread] 

List:       sas-l
Subject:    SAS Forum: (elegant solution) Delete all Columns that contain a certain String
From:       Roger DeAngelis <rogerjdeangelis () GMAIL ! COM>
Date:       2017-03-31 14:03:40
Message-ID: 7528077390351850.WA.rogerjdeangelisgmail.com () listserv ! uga ! edu
[Download RAW message or body]

SAS Forum: (elegant solution) Delete all Columns that contain a certain String

see
https://goo.gl/PYQZ4k
https://communities.sas.com/t5/Base-SAS-Programming/Delete-all-Columns-that-contain-a-certain-String/m-p/346141


very slight change with drop statement

proc sql noprint;
  SELECT name INTO :dropMe SEPARATED BY ' '
  FROM sashelp.vcolumn
  WHERE libname = 'YOURLIB' AND
                memname = 'HAVE' AND
                prxmatch('/het$/i', strip(name)) > 0;
quit;

data want;
  set have(drop=&dropMe);
run;


[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ic